Ralph Klein served as premier of Alberta for over a decade, leaving a complex and often debated legacy. Remembered for his fiscal conservatism and pioneering approach to politics, Klein implemented strategies that transformed the province's economic landscape. His advocacy for resource development stimulated Alberta's growth, but also raised doubts about its environmental impact and social sustainability. Klein's methods was often controversial, igniting strong reactions from both supporters and critics. His continued influence on Alberta is undeniable, but the full extent of his legacy remains a subject of ongoing analysis.
Command of Alison Redford
Alison Redford's premiership as Premier of Alberta sparked during a time of unprecedented economic boom. The oilsands industry was booming, fueling government coffers and promises of abundant future. Redford, christened as "the new face of Alberta," quickly won over the public's imagination with her appeal. She championed initiatives like environmental preservation and a renewed focus on social welfare, promising a more progressive direction for the province. However, by 2014, Alberta's economy began to struggle as oil prices plummeted. This downturn forced Redford's government into a series of austerity cuts, sparking public discontent.
